Full Job Description
Who are we looking for?

We are seeking a highly skilled Technical Service Engineer who combines strong technical expertise with excellent customer-facing skills. The ideal candidate will have experience in specialty chemicals or related industries, a passion for solving complex technical challenges, and the ability to support customers with innovative solutions that drive business growth.

What will you be doing?
  • Provides customers with on-site process expertise, chemical change implementation, monitoringand hands-on process control assistance for the manufacture of printed circuit boards
  • Understands and articulates PCB chemical functions and related process requirements tocustomers
  • Performs regular health checks and process audits for various production processes at customersites, generates reports and reviews with end users
  • Assists with regular lab testing functions/analysis with customer lab personnel and providestraining, when necessary, on best practice functions, tests and analysis.
  • Troubleshoots and diagnoses equipment and or process problems and provides hands-on supportto correct problems and optimize customer manufacturing processes.
  • Adheres to plant and corporate safety policies.
  • May assist in other areas or perform other duties as required by fluctuating business needs.
  • Coordinates daily activities with territory Account Manager and Business Director
  • Is an expert and steward for customer final product quality using MacDermid products
  • Identifies opportunities for growth at all customer locations
  • Assists with the monitoring and control of on-hand inventory at customer site
Who are You?
  • Bachelors (required) or Masters (preferred) in Chemistry or related field
  • Strong understanding of chemistry and chemical interaction within the PCB manufacturing process
  • Willingness to travel within the assigned territory and periodically to accounts in North America Eastern Region
  • Six Sigma knowledge would be good but not required, company training available
